Water damage can lead to important issues for homeowners and businesses alike. Understanding the frequent causes of water damage and the way to prevent it could save time, cash, and stress. Home Flooding Service Lexington KY.


One prevalent explanation for water damage is plumbing leaks. Leaky pipes can go unnoticed for extended periods, causing gradual damage to partitions, ceilings, and floors. It is essential to frequently inspect plumbing methods for signs of wear and tear and tear. Even minor leaks can lead to mold growth and structural damage if not addressed promptly.


Another frequent wrongdoer is heavy rainfall or flooding. Storms can overwhelm drainage methods and result in water intrusion in basements and crawl areas. Homeowners should make sure that their properties have correct drainage and that gutters are clear and functioning appropriately to divert water away from the foundation.

Roof leaks are also common, especially after extreme weather. Damaged shingles or clogged gutters can permit water to seep into the home. Regular roof inspections and upkeep can prevent these leaks before they cause damage.


Appliance malfunctions can create surprising water damage. Washing machines, dishwashers, and water heaters are important in day by day life however can become sources of leaks if not periodically inspected. Homeowners ought to regularly check hoses and connections to keep away from sudden malfunctions.

Condensation can result in water damage, notably in areas with high humidity. Bathrooms, kitchens, and laundry rooms can accumulate moisture, contributing to mildew and mold progress. Proper ventilation is important in these areas to maintain a balanced humidity level.

Improperly sealed home windows and doorways also can permit water to infiltrate. Over time, put on and tear could cause seals to interrupt down, leading to leaks during rainstorms. Regularly inspecting and resealing home windows and doors might help shield towards water damage.


Clogged drains and downspouts can lead to overflow, especially in periods of intense rainfall. It is important to maintain these areas clear to ensure correct water circulate. Cleaning gutters and downspouts twice a year can prevent important buildup and potential water damage.


Foundation cracks can enable water to enter a house, notably during heavy rains. Inspecting the foundation for any signs of cracks or fissures is essential. If cracks are detected, they should be repaired immediately to stop water intrusion.


Natural disasters like hurricanes or tornadoes usually result in vital water damage. While these occasions can't be prevented, homeowners can take precautions such as securing unfastened objects within the yard and installing flood obstacles to reduce the damage from such catastrophic occasions.

Prevention methods can greatly reduce the chance of water damage. Installing water leak sensors can present early warnings of leaks, allowing for prompt action. These sensors could be placed near home equipment and in basements to observe water ranges repeatedly.


Regular upkeep of landscaping can also contribute to preventing water damage. Ensuring that soil and vegetation slopes away from the home might help direct rainwater away from the inspiration. This simple step can significantly mitigate the chance of water intrusion.

Furthermore, it is advisable to make certain that sump pumps are functioning accurately. Many properties depend on sump pumps to take away excess water from basements. Regular testing of those pumps and making certain they're in working order could be a lifesaver during heavy rains.

  • Aging plumbing techniques can develop leaks; common inspections and well timed replacement of old pipes can mitigate risks.

  • Heavy rainfall can result in flooding; landscaping adjustments similar to proper drainage systems might help redirect water away from the foundation.

  • Broken or malfunctioning appliances, like washing machines or dishwashers, can leak; routine maintenance checks are essential to make sure they operate accurately.

  • Ice dams can type on roofs during winter, causing water to again up; guaranteeing adequate insulation and ventilation can prevent their formation.

  • Sewer backups usually occur because of clogs; putting in a backwater valve can protect properties from sewage overflow.

  • Clogged gutters prevent rainwater from draining effectively; regular cleansing and downspout inspections are crucial for optimum water move.

  • Humidity and condensation can result in mold growth; utilizing dehumidifiers and making certain correct ventilation in damp areas can help control moisture ranges.

  • Foundation cracks can permit water seepage; sealing these cracks with waterproofing compounds can shield in opposition to water intrusion.

  • Poorly designed irrigation systems can lead to overwatering; adjusting sprinkler timing and placing them strategically can prevent excess moisture damage.

  • Tree roots can invade sewer strains, leading to blockages; maintaining trees at a secure distance from plumbing infrastructure might help avoid Restoration Fire And Water Lexington KY potential points.
